Disruptive Africa Conference Focuses On Digital Business Evolution in Nigeria, Africa

disruptive con.jpg

Computers and Technologies are exponentially getting more powerful and will take away millions of jobs but creating even bigger opportunities hence companies and organisations are now virtualizing key business value chain processes into platforms and digital networks.

Thus, the Fourth Industrial revolution is here, David Alozie, the convener, Disruptive Africa Conference, said, but with a clause that despite the fact these technologies are already altering the business value chains around some parts of the world, Nigeria/Africa is yet to start taking a lead role towards a Knowledge Economy.

According to Alozie, Digital Economy is what will fuel research and Innovation through disruptive technologies.

“This could hinder and slow down economic growth and National development in Nigeria/Africa.

“There is great need for key industry players both in the Public and private sectors to partner and come together to discuss, collaboratively learn and strategize on ways to leverage this technologies in order to remain market relevant, accelerate business growth, competitiveness and sustainability which will in turn trigger exponential economic growth in Nigeria.

To this end, Alozie and his team are allying other key industry players for the 3rd edition of the Disruptive Africa Conference to discuss these issues.

The conference with the theme: “Digital Business Evolution: The Future is here” sets to dwell mainly on Internet of Things (IoT), Smart Cities, Big Data, Robotics, AI, 3D printing

The two day-event holds 13th-14th September, 2017 at the Four Points by Sheraton, Lekki, Lagos
